Mark Ruffalo The Next Hulk?

It has been the subject of rumour since the not so acrimonious split between Marvel and Edward Norton earlier this month; but not without a lot of head scratching. Much in the same sense that the sentence: Edward Norton in a big budget CGI comic book franchise poses; is Mark Ruffalo's involvement as Norton's replacement. But it appears that the deal is done, according to Deadline.

But there is an obvious link; Marvel want an actor's actor to fulfil the role of Bruce Banner in their franchise. They are films that studio's executives scramble for the Chris Evans', Chris Pines' and Shia Le Beoufs' of the acting world; Yet in the case of Hulk the attendance register now reads, Eric Bana [Munich], Edward Norton [American History X] and Mark Ruffalo [Zodiac]. This is not your average 'go to' list for a comic book adaptation.

No confirmation as of yet, but with comic con still rolling why waste a big exclusive reveal if you can help it right?.

Edward Norton You Wont Like Him When He's Angry

You may, as we did at first, think that the picture of Edward Norton was possibly a candid photo taken from his recent meeting between Marvel Studios; who, as it happens has just unceremoniously dumped Norton from reprising his incarnation of the Hulk from the upcoming The Avengers. The reason is beautifully ironic.


A statement from Marvel Studio's President of Production Kevin Fiege read:


“We have made the decision to not bring Ed Norton back to portray the title role of Bruce Banner in TheAvengers. Our decision is definitely not one based on monetary factors, but instead rooted in the need for an actor who embodies the creativity and collaborative spirit of our other talented cast members. The Avengers demands players who thrive working as part of an ensemble, as evidenced by Robert, Chris H, Chris E, Sam, Scarlett, and all of our talented casts. We are looking to announce a name actor who fulfills these requirements, and is passionate about the iconic role in the coming weeks.”


So what is being implied by Fiege is that the giant green bastard does not like to play nice and share his toy's with the other monster's, well... no shit. Honestly, we are thankful for the news. Hopefully, just maybe, with contractual obligations torn up with Marvel and the Hulk, Norton can get back to testing roles with depth, because there is no doubting he is a fine actor.
